Quickie® Rhythm™ Power Wheelchair
Wheelchair Description:
The Quickie® Rhythm™ is one of the most advanced power chairs in today's marketplace. Features like 6-Form Suspension™ and Leveler™ technology forge a new frontier in power-chair suspension.
The Rhythm™ is also one of three drive-wheel base-types (front-wheel, mid-wheel, and rear-wheel) that are designed to interface with either a standard Rehab seating system or the new A.S.A.P.™ seating system. The result: a comprehensive modular approach that combines simplicity with flexibility.

| In addition to 6-form suspension, the Quickie® Rhythm™ also uses Leveler™ technology. Leveler technology dampens the forward pitching that is sometimes experienced when braking while traveling down a hill or transitioning from a ramp to a flat surface. Leveler™ technology helps ensure that the drive wheels maintains steady contact with the ground. |
| Quickie® iQ electronics takes user safety very seriously. This is why the new iQ motor controllers are programmed to keep the motors running anytime thermal rollback (or overheating) occurs. Most electronic manufacturers program their motor controllers to shut down during a thermal rollback. However, this can be dangerous if a chair is in the middle of a busy intersection. This is why our iQ motor controllers are designed to reduce power in a series of steps when a controller goes into thermal rollback. |
| For some users, transferring in and out of a power chair to a car, van, or truck seat can be difficult and time consuming. This is why The Quickie® Rhythm™ features an optional transit tie-down system. This system can be purchased with the chair or as a retro-kit at a later date |
| The Quickie® Rhythm™ features only high output 4-pole motors. For a performance chair, it is critical that power and reliability are not compromised. It is no surprise that the 4-pole motor, with its proven track record, was chosen for the job. |
| Intuitive torque is another way Quickie® iQ electronics help create the optimal ride. Intuitive torque ensures that plenty of backup power is quickly available at low speeds when chairs need a boost to clear doorstops or climb obstacles. At high speeds, this same backup power is available in smaller more controlled amounts, which prevents dangerous overcompensation that often contributes to erratic chair performance. |
| A common complaint with many power swing-away footrests is that the release levers tend to catch on doorways and other obstacles. To address this problem, Quickie® Rhythm™ footrests are designed with a flat release-lever profile. This new design also features a stout locking mechanism and steel construction. |
Wheelchair Specifications:

| Built to meet the requirements of HCPCS code: |
K0848, K0850, K0856, K0858, K0861, K0868, K0877, K0884 |

| Models: | Rhythm™ BC - K0848 Rhythm™ BC HD - K0850 Rhythm™ SC - K0856 Rhythm™ SC HD - K0858 Rhythm™ MPC - K0861 Rhythm™ BD - K0868 Rhythm™ SD - K0877 Rhythm™ MPD - K0884 |
| Wheelchair Weight: | Approx. 155 lbs. w/o batteries |
| Overall Base Width: | 25.5" |
| Overall Length: | 39" |
| Shipping Method(s): | Freight Carrier |
| Wheelchair Weight Capacity: | 300 lbs. and 400 lbs. on HD models |
| Seat to Floor Height: | 17" - 20" (All Models) |
| Speed: | 6.5 mph and 5.0 mph on HD models |
| Turning Radius: | 21" |
| Seat Width: | 14" - 24" (Rhythm™ SC HD & Rhythm™ BC HD: 15" - 24") |
| Seat Depth: | 12" - 24" |
| Seat/Back Type: | Rehab, A.S.A.P.™, S.P.O.T.®, & Power Recline |
| Transit Option: | Yes |
| Caster Options: | 6" |
| Battery Type: | Group 24, 22 NF |
| Drive Wheel Size: | 14" |
| Drive Tire: | Knobby, V-Groove |
| Drive Wheel Type: | Mid-Wheel Drive |
